The Link Between Procurement and Aircraft Availability

Aircraft maintenance teams rely on a steady supply of quality components to keep operations running smoothly. When a required part is unavailable or delayed, maintenance schedules can be extended, leading to additional downtime. Strategic procurement helps organizations avoid these challenges by ensuring access to trusted suppliers, reliable inventory sources, and responsive RFQ services.

Rather than waiting for a component failure to occur, many operators now take a proactive approach by identifying critical parts in advance and establishing sourcing relationships that support rapid fulfillment. This reduces uncertainty and helps maintenance teams respond more effectively when urgent requirements arise.

Building a Resilient Supply Chain Strategy

Successful aviation organizations recognize that procurement is not simply about purchasing parts when needed. Instead, it involves building a resilient supply chain capable of supporting long-term operational goals.

This includes maintaining relationships with trusted suppliers, monitoring inventory requirements, and leveraging procurement platforms that offer access to a broad network of manufacturers and distributors. As supply chain challenges continue to affect the aerospace industry, organizations that invest in strategic sourcing are often better positioned to maintain operational continuity and avoid costly delays.
